Una pantalla genética para los candidatos a supresores de tumores identifica REST
Thomas F Westbrook1, Eric S Martin, Michael R Schlabach
1Howard Hughes Medical Institute, Department of Genetics, Harvard Partners Center for Genetics and Genomics, Harvard Medical School, 77 Avenue Louis Pasteur, Boston, Massachusetts 02115, USA.
Los investigadores identificaron REST/NRSF como un nuevo gen supresor de tumores. La pérdida de REST promueve el cáncer al aumentar la señalización PI(3)K, ofreciendo nuevas vías para el descubrimiento de genes de cáncer.

Sus antecedentes:
- La tumorigénesis implica cambios genéticos y epigenéticos complejos.
- La identificación de genes clave que impulsan la transformación maligna es crucial para la investigación del cáncer.
Objetivo del estudio:
- Para identificar los genes que suprimen la transformación maligna en las células epiteliales mamarias humanas utilizando una pantalla de RNAi.
- Investigar el papel de REST/NRSF en el desarrollo del cáncer.
Principales métodos:
- Prueba genética basada en la interferencia de ARN (RNAi) para los supresores de transformación.
- Array híbridación genómica comparativa (Array-CGH) para las alteraciones genéticas.
- Análisis de mutación en células de cáncer colorrectal.
Principales resultados:
- Se identificaron supresores de tumores conocidos (TGFBR2, PTEN) y un nuevo supresor, REST/NRSF.
- Se encontraron deleciones de REST en el cáncer colorrectal y una mutación transformadora de REST.
- Se ha demostrado que las células deficientes en REST dependen de la señalización PI ((3) K para la transformación.
Conclusiones:
- REST funciona como un supresor de tumores humano, no reconocido previamente.
- La pérdida de REST contribuye al cáncer a través de la activación de la vía PI(3)K.
- Este estudio proporciona un método para descubrir nuevos genes que suprimen el cáncer.
